On this week's show:
iProng Radio co-hosts Bill Palmer and Dana Sanders discuss the hundred millionth iPod sold, Bill's PodCamp NYC adventures, and iProng's announcement regarding Podcast Expo. Bill and Dana also interview Jared from the band Augustana, and John C. Havens stops by to talk about PodCamp NYC from an organizer's perspective.

Eighteen months after releasing their debut album All The Stars And Boulevards, Augustana is an overnight sensation on the strength of their hit single Boston. Jared talks about how the album came together and what's next for Augustana.

Last weekend's PodCamp NYC was the largest PodCamp in history, and lead organizer John C. Havens drops by to chat with Bill about how things went.
